Who can apply for Post Matric Scholarship?
- A candidate from class 11 to Ph.D. can apply for the scholarship.
- Candidates must belong to SC/ST/OBC/EBC or any other minority community.
- Candidate must have a family income of not more than ₹ 2-lakh p.a.
Post Matric Scholarship Eligibility criteria
- Candidates from classes 11, 12, UG, PG, M.Phil. Ph.D. or Diploma.
- The candidate must be from the minority community.
- The applicant must have scored at least 50% marks in the last final examination.
- Candidate must have a family income of not more than ₹ 2-lakh p.a.

How to apply for Pre-Matric Scholarship Application online?
- Visit the homepage of the National Scholarship Portal www.scholarships.gov.in.
- Click on ‘Ministry of Minority Affairs’ under the ‘State scheme’
- Select the undertaking and continue.
- Carefully read ‘Post Matric Scholarship Scheme Guidelines’
- Search for New Registration and Click on it.
- In the following application form, fill up all necessary details regarding personal information, academic details, contact information, and other requisite details.
- Provide the bank details such as branch name, bank name, account holder name, IFSC code, and MICR code.
- Provide details regarding the identification of the candidate. Provide any identity card, which must be issued by State/Central Government.
- Verification of mobile no. will be done, and an OTP will be generated.
- The next step is to log in using the OTP and fill the form.
- An application ID and password will be generated. Use that for future references.
Documents required for Pre-Matric Scholarship
- Domicile Certificate
- Attested copy of the community certificate.
- Attested copies of disability certificate, if any.
- Page one of bank passbook having bank name, branch name, account holder name, IFSC code, and MICR code.
- Scanned copy of school/college mark sheet and certificates.
- Income certificate of candidates’ parents.

Post-Matric Scholarship Selection Process
- The number of seats available for the Post-Matric Scholarship is limited. Candidates belonging to SC/ST/OBC and those who lie below the poverty line are eligible for scholarship. The candidates lying BPL will be given preference.
Post-Matric Scholarship Renewal Process
- Post-Matric scholarship must be renewed every year. The attendance of the candidates must be at least 50% to be eligible for the scholarship.
- The renewal process for the next academic year will only start once the candidate is produced.
